In a nutshell, I (and others) have been using the voice control of Alexa to tell Plex to select music (and video) stored and served by my WD NAS to play the media on a stereo, TV, and other devices such as a Roku and an Alexa Dot (via its audio out) to the stereo. Right now, my stereo is playing music by an artist I told Alexa to have Plex play. Example command: “Alexa, ask Plex to play Miles Davis” and his music tracks begin playing on the stereo.
